[ARCHIVED] City Wood Waste Recycling Facility Is Open

The City of Twin Falls Wood Waste Recycling Facility is open for the 2012 summer season.

The facility, located at 987 Rose Street, is open each Saturday from 2 to 7 p.m. until Aug. 25, and from 12 to 5 p.m. until Oct. 27.

Citizens can dispose of any clean wood waste free of charge. Acceptable materials include: unpainted lumber, pallets, tree limbs up to 32 inches in diameter, leaves, shrubs and wood shingles. Items that are not acceptable include: wood treated with creosote, painted wood, stumps with significant earth matter, logs or limbs over 32 inches in diameter and waste from commercial activities.

The purpose of the wood waste recycling facility is to reduce the amount of landfill material by converting yard and wood wastes into material suitable for alternative uses. The chipped wood waste will be available for anyone on a first come, first serve basis.

Only City of Twin Falls residential households are eligible to participate in this no-cost program. Citizens are asked to bring a copy of their water bill to verify proof of residency.
